Biography
Whats good,
My name is Kontents on the forums, but my stage name is still in the makings as I myself am still finding my nitch in the game. I have been officially making instrumentals for three years now, but have been in the Rap/Hip Hop scene for about eight years. I started in the beginning writing lyrics without any attempts of actually rapping. After a while I slowly progressed and began rapping,
but found it unbelievably hard to find unused instrumentals. So I started out with FL 4 with absolutely no idea of what I was doing. Of course this being my very first attempt at it...the beats sucked.
I found FL to lack the warmth I wanted to achieve. I eventually bought Propellerheads Reason and found my tool to work with and have been making beats with it ever since.
My goal with my music is the same as anybody else on this grind, making music I am proud of and can share as well as making a decent income from it. I ain't looking to become a rockstar, but to live doing something I love is a big dream of mine.
